Buying Guide

  • Fabric performance: prioritize moisture-wicking, quick-drying materials and breathable panels to maintain comfort during long rounds.
  • Layering flexibility: look for base layers with 4-way stretch and brushed interiors for warmth without bulk.
  • Sun protection: UPF ratings add value for golfers who spend extended periods outdoors; UPF 50+ is common in performance polos.
  • Odor control: anti-odor technologies can help sustain freshness after multiple holes and practice sessions.
  • Fit and mobility: choose garments with stretch fabrics and ergonomic cuts that support full range of motion in the swing.
  • Care and durability: consider fabrics that resist wear and retain shape after washing to extend wardrobe life.
  • Versatility: select apparel that can transition from on-course play to casual wear without needing a full change.
